Palm Beach Island is home to fewer than 10,000 permanent residents yet contains some of the most valuable real estate in the United States.
Palm Beach Island: the market
The island is characterized by a strict zoning code that limits building height, preserves architectural character, and maintains the extraordinary sense of space and quiet that defines Palm Beach living. Oceanfront properties typically start around $15 million and regularly exceed $50 million for estates with significant ocean frontage and pool and beach amenities. The north end of the island, near The Breakers, tends to command the highest prices. South Palm Beach (a separate municipality) offers oceanfront at slightly lower price points.
